AN IVORY 'DOUBLE-GOURD' POMANDER
19TH CENTURY
The pomander is naturalistically shaped as a double-gourd and is pierced with geometric designs. It is carved attached to a leafy flowering branch bearing smaller gourds. A butterfly is depicted in flight beside the branch.
3½ in. (9 cm.) long
